what's the difference between a megane with the silver badges on the body side moulds and the ones with just plain black? I have asked around but cant get an answer,

does your silver panel have the engine size and type on it, ie 1.4 16V, 2.0 16V, 2.0 vvti, 1.5Dci, , 1,9 Dci?
if so then we are on the same track, old phase 1 models had a silver badge leading into the side strip telling the world what size engine and type you were packing for some reason the phase 2 had this removed and replaced with a part the same as the rest of strip, my old 05 plate laguna had same marker and ive seen scenics with them..
